Tony Smith: Wall, New Piece, One-Two-Three
July 14 through August 18, 2023
Tony Smith considered his process to be intuitive, his work resting close to the unconscious and exploring themes of spirituality and presence in a synthesis of geometric abstraction and expressionism.

Song Dong: Round
July 14 through August 18, 2023
Song Dong (Chinese: 宋冬, born 1966) is a Chinese contemporary artist, active in sculpture, installations, performance, photography and video.
